“Cookies for gas”: Local 638 members raise $500 to Save the MNR; Local 635 hits the front page

The Save the MNR Bake Sale on Dec. 14 was a huge success for the members of Local 638 in Hearst. Members from three ministries got together and baked over 150 plates of various Christmas goodies. The local distributed posters in town and contacted the media to advertise this lunchtime event in the MNR Warehouse. OPSEU members and members of the community bought $535.36 worth of home-made goods. Radio Canada, Journal le Nord, Northern Times and CINN-FM attended the event to interview Local 638 president Lynn Alary and learn more about the Save the MNR campaign.   The best photo of the day is of town councilor André Rhéaume buying cookies from Bonny Fournier and Yvan Proulx as they put gas in a Conservation Officer’s truck.

In North Bay, Local 635 steward Dave Fluri made the front page of the North Bay Nugget and was on the radio across the north Thursday morning. Local 635 will stage a photo opportunity for media in North Bay today to put gas in an MNR vehicle.

Public support for both events was very high. MNR offices and Service Ontario received dozens of calls looking for the bake sales and voicing their support for the campaign.   - Suzanne Morin, L. 638 vice-president, and OPSEU Communications
